#ebaf9c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ebaf9c is composed of 92.2% red, 68.6%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.5% magenta, 33.6%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 14.4 degrees, a saturation of 66.4% and a lightness of 76.7%. #ebaf9c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d75f39. Closest websafe color is: #ff9999.

Shades and Tints of #ebaf9c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0603 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.
